html,body,div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,abbr,address,cite,code,del,dfn,em,img,ins,kbd,q,samp,small,strong,sub,sup,var,b,i,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,dialog,figure,footer,header,hgroup,nav,section,menu,time,mark,audio,video{margin:0;padding:0;border:0;outline:0;vertical-align:baseline;background-color:rgba(0,0,0,0)}body{line-height:1}article,aside,dialog,figure,footer,header,hgroup,nav,section{display:block}ul{list-style:none}blockquote,q{quotes:none}blockquote::before,blockquote::after,q::before,q::after{content:"";content:none}a{margin:0;padding:0;border:0;font-size:100%;vertical-align:baseline;background:rgba(0,0,0,0)}hr{display:block;height:1px;border:0;margin:0;padding:0}input,button,text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none;outline:0;border-radius:0}select{outline:0;border-radius:0}input,textarea{padding:0;background-color:inherit;border:none}iframe[name=google_conversion_frame]{height:0 !important;width:0 !important;line-height:0 !important;font-size:0 !important;margin-top:-13px}@font-face{font-family:zen-old-mincho-regular;src:url("../../font/zen-old-mincho/ZenOldMincho-Regular.ttf") format("opentype")}@font-face{font-family:zen-old-mincho-medium;src:url("../../font/zen-old-mincho/ZenOldMincho-Medium.ttf") format("opentype")}@font-face{font-family:eb-garamond-regular;src:url("../../font/eb-garamond/EBGaramond-Regular.ttf") format("opentype")}@font-face{font-family:eb-garamond-medium;src:url("../../font/eb-garamond/EBGaramond-Medium.ttf") format("opentype")}@font-face{font-family:nunito-regular;src:url("../../font/nunito/Nunito-Regular.ttf") format("opentype")}@font-face{font-family:nunito-semibold;src:url("../../font/nunito/Nunito-SemiBold.ttf") format("opentype")}@font-face{font-family:roboto-regular;src:url("../../font/roboto/Roboto-Regular.ttf") format("opentype");font-weight:normal;font-style:normal}.accommodation-contract{padding-top:70px}@media screen and (min-width: 835px){.accommodation-contract{padding-top:94px;place-content:center}}.accommodation-contract__inner{grid-column:2/3;padding:55px 7px 0}@media screen and (min-width: 835px){.accommodation-contract__inner{grid-column:1/-1;display:grid;padding:127px 0 0;grid-template-columns:12.5% auto 12.5%;margin-inline:auto;max-width:1536px}}.accommodation-contract__inner:lang(en){padding-top:54px}@media screen and (min-width: 835px){.accommodation-contract__inner:lang(en){padding-top:127px}}@media screen and (min-width: 835px){.accommodation-contract__container{grid-column:2/3}}.accommodation-contract__title{font-size:1.9rem;line-height:3.515rem;letter-spacing:.1em}@media screen and (min-width: 835px){.accommodation-contract__title{font-size:2rem;line-height:3.7rem}}.accommodation-contract__title:lang(en){font-size:2rem;line-height:3.5rem;letter-spacing:.05em}@media screen and (min-width: 835px){.accommodation-contract__title:lang(en){font-size:2.1rem;line-height:3.675rem}}.accommodation-contract__lead{margin-top:49px;font-size:1.4rem;line-height:2.8rem;letter-spacing:.1em}@media screen and (min-width: 835px){.accommodation-contract__lead{margin-top:80px}}.listWrapper{margin-top:37px;border-top:solid 1px #d4d1d0;padding-top:40px}@media screen and (min-width: 835px){.listWrapper{margin-top:78px;padding-top:50px}}.listWrapper:lang(en){margin-top:38px}@media screen and (min-width: 835px){.listWrapper:lang(en){margin-top:78px}}.list{display:grid;row-gap:38.4px}@media screen and (min-width: 835px){.list{row-gap:48.4px}}.list:lang(en){row-gap:38.8px}@media screen and (min-width: 835px){.list:lang(en){row-gap:49px}}.list__title{font-family:zen-old-mincho-medium,serif;font-size:1.4rem;line-height:2.8rem;letter-spacing:.11em}.list__title:lang(en){font-family:eb-garamond-medium,zen-old-mincho-medium,serif;font-size:1.5rem;line-height:2.4rem;letter-spacing:.05em}.list__texts{font-size:1.3rem;line-height:2.6rem;letter-spacing:.1em}.list__texts:lang(en){font-size:1.4rem;line-height:2.24rem;letter-spacing:.05em}.list__title+.list__texts{margin-top:13px}.subList{display:grid;row-gap:26px}.subList:lang(en){row-gap:23px}.subList--secondLevel{row-gap:unset}.subList--secondLevel:lang(en){row-gap:unset}.subList--secondLevel .subList__number:lang(en){width:30px}.subList--secondLevel .subList__texts{-moz-column-gap:unset;column-gap:unset}.subList--secondLevel .subList__texts:lang(en){row-gap:unset}.subList--thirdLevel{row-gap:unset}.subList--thirdLevel:lang(en){row-gap:unset}.subList--thirdLevel .subList__texts{-moz-column-gap:unset;column-gap:unset}.subList--thirdLevel .subList__texts:lang(en){row-gap:unset}.subList--thirdLevel .subList__textInner:lang(en){flex:1}.subList--thirdLevel .subList__number{width:40px}.subList--thirdLevel .subList__number:lang(en){width:28px}.en-sp-mt-3:lang(en){margin-top:3px}@media screen and (min-width: 835px){.en-sp-mt-3:lang(en){margin-top:0}}.en-sp-mt-4:lang(en){margin-top:4px}@media screen and (min-width: 835px){.en-sp-mt-4:lang(en){margin-top:0}}.en-sp-mt-13:lang(en){margin-top:13px}@media screen and (min-width: 835px){.en-sp-mt-13:lang(en){margin-top:0}}@media screen and (min-width: 835px){.en-pc-mt-4:lang(en){margin-top:4px}}@media screen and (min-width: 835px){.en-pc-mt-5:lang(en){margin-top:5px}}.list__texts+.subList{margin-top:28px}@media screen and (min-width: 835px){.list__texts+.subList{margin-top:26px}}.subList__texts{display:flex;-moz-column-gap:7px;column-gap:7px;font-size:1.3rem;line-height:2.6rem;letter-spacing:.1em}@media screen and (min-width: 835px){.subList__texts{-moz-column-gap:8px;column-gap:8px}}.subList__texts:lang(en){font-size:1.4rem;line-height:2.198rem;letter-spacing:.05em}.subList__textInner:lang(en){flex:1}.subList__number{font-family:zen-old-mincho-regular,serif}.subList__number:lang(en){font-family:eb-garamond-regular,zen-old-mincho-regular,serif}.sublist__text:lang(en){line-height:2.1rem}.list__text+.subList{margin-top:27px}.list__title+.subList{margin-top:15px}.list__title+.subList:lang(en){margin-top:14px}.list__title+.subList:lang(en):lang(en){margin-top:13px}.terms{margin-top:40px;border-top:solid 1px #d4d1d0;padding-top:31px;font-family:zen-old-mincho-medium,serif;font-size:1.3rem;line-height:2.6rem;letter-spacing:.1em;text-align:right}@media screen and (min-width: 835px){.terms{margin-top:47px}}.terms:lang(en){margin-top:36px;padding-top:31px;font-family:eb-garamond-regular,zen-old-mincho-regular,serif;font-size:1.4rem;line-height:2.24rem;letter-spacing:.05em;text-align:left}@media screen and (min-width: 835px){.terms:lang(en){margin-top:49px;padding-top:29px}}.terms__details{display:flex;justify-content:flex-end;-moz-column-gap:13px;column-gap:13px}@media screen and (min-width: 835px){.terms__details{-moz-column-gap:12px;column-gap:12px}}.terms__details p:last-child{width:106px}
